A wonderful opportunity for those interested in learning about art, museums, are education, and material preparation. The Discovery Room at Glenbow provides art-based activities for both children and adults guests. Volunteers will work alongside museum educators to engage the public in art activities related to current museum exhibitions. Volunteers will assist with activities and projects, demonstrate artistic techniques (which they will be taught), tidying activity stations, and preparing art materials. Public engagement in collaborative art will take place on Stephen Avenue Mall during Stampede Week. As well, volunteers can receive artifact handling training during public programming. We are seeking volunteers who are friendly, who enjoy working with the public and children, are reliable and committed, and enjoy teamwork in a busy setting. Opportunities are primarily available between 12:00 to 3:00pm or 1:00 to 4:00pm on Saturdays and Sundays, as well as 5:00 to 8:00pm on Fridays. A minimum of two shifts per month is suggested aside from when you may be away on family/ personal holidays or activities as the schedule is flexible.
